> This week Jens started re-testing the opecl compiler after OSX 10.7.4
> updates.
> There is an overall progress, but I'm still having some issues. They may
> even be different than his'.
>
> My test device: AMD Radeon HD 6750M
>
> I had to disable CL_NO_FLOAT3 and enable KERNEL_SHADING.
> If the NO_FLOAT3 is on the kernels don't build (*)
>
> (1) good render: http://www.pasteall.org/pic/31736
> (2) bad gpu viewport: http://www.pasteall.org/pic/31738
> (3) terrible gpu render: http://www.pasteall.org/pic/31737
>
> ((2) and (3) also tested with screen size matching render size and tile
> size on its maximum)
>
> I remember running into the problem in (2) with opencl in linux and even
> with cuda. the problem in (3) may be something unique though.
